Output 85412500968c34dcba7ecfde4312457dd6eea2a72a2b24899db418d3aa9a8b95:65

value
15470040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4c3337ce93d440d546428be32f945cb618ae43 OP_EQUAL
address
3QnLAYtK4aUzZA4eRn4gyL1XjnayEQdQWu
transaction
85412500968c34dcba7ecfde4312457dd6eea2a72a2b24899db418d3aa9a8b95
spent
true